Introduction

The rise of artificial intelligence (AI) has ushered in a new era of technological advancements, transforming various industries, including the creative realm of music video production. AI-assisted tools offer exciting opportunities for artists and creators to produce visually captivating music videos with unprecedented ease and accessibility.


The traditional process of creating music videos often involved considerable time, resources, and expertise, rendering it a challenge for independent artists and small production teams with limited budgets. However, the advent of AI-powered tools has democratized the music video creation process, empowering artists to bring their visions to life with greater efficiency and creativity.


One of the primary benefits of AI in music video creation is the potential for time and cost savings.

AI algorithms can automate various tasks, such as video editing, visual effects, and motion graphics, streamlining the production process and reducing the need for extensive manual labor. This not only saves time but also makes high-quality music video production more affordable for artists with limited resources.


Moreover, AI-assisted tools can enhance creativity by generating unique and visually stunning visuals, effects, and styles that might be difficult or time-consuming to achieve through traditional methods. This fusion of human artistry and AI-generated elements opens up new realms of creative expression and allows for the exploration of innovative and captivating visual narratives.


However, as with any emerging technology, the use of AI in artistic endeavors raises ethical considerations. Concerns have been raised about AI's potential to replace human creativity and artistic expression, as well as the importance of respecting intellectual property rights and avoiding copyright infringement when using AI-generated content.


The Evolution of Music Video Production

The art of music video creation has undergone a remarkable transformation over the decades. In the early days, music videos were primarily filmed and edited using traditional cinematographic techniques, relying heavily on manual labor and specialized expertise.


As digital technology advanced, the introduction of video editing software and visual effects tools revolutionized the music video production process. Artists and creators gained greater control over their creative visions, allowing for more intricate and polished final products.


However, despite these advancements, the process of creating high-quality music videos remained time-consuming and resource-intensive, often presenting significant challenges for independent artists and small production teams with limited budgets and resources.


The need for accessible and cost-effective solutions in the music video production process became increasingly apparent, paving the way for the integration of AI technology into this creative field.


AI-Assisted Music Video Creation: How It Works

AI-assisted music video creation relies on various cutting-edge technologies, including machine learning, computer vision, and generative adversarial networks (GANs). These advanced algorithms are capable of analyzing and understanding complex visual data, enabling them to generate, manipulate, and enhance visual content in unprecedented ways.


The process typically begins with an artist or creator providing input, such as music, concept ideas, or reference images. AI algorithms then analyze this input and generate a range of visual elements, including:


  • Video footage
  • Visual effects
  • Motion graphics
  • Stylized filters and effects


These AI-generated visuals can be seamlessly integrated into the music video production process, either as standalone elements or in combination with traditional footage and effects.


One of the key advantages of AI-assisted music video creation is the ability to automate and streamline various tasks. For example, AI algorithms can automatically synchronize visual elements with the music's rhythm and tempo, creating a cohesive and visually engaging experience.


Additionally, AI-powered software and platforms offer user-friendly interfaces, allowing artists and creators with varying levels of technical expertise to leverage these advanced tools effectively.

Ethical Considerations in AI-Assisted Music Video Creation

While AI offers exciting opportunities in music video production, its use in artistic endeavors raises important ethical considerations that must be addressed:


  1. Preserving Human Creativity and Artistic Expression: Concerns have been raised about AI's potential to replace human creativity and artistic expression. It is crucial to strike a balance between leveraging AI's capabilities and preserving the unique voices and artistic visions of human creators.
  2. Intellectual Property Rights and Copyright Infringement: When using AI-generated content, it is essential to respect intellectual property rights and avoid copyright infringement. Artists and creators should ensure they have the necessary permissions and licenses for any third-party content or assets used in their AI-assisted music video productions.
  3. Ethical Implications of Synthetic Media: The use of AI to manipulate or create synthetic media, such as deepfakes, raises ethical concerns regarding the potential for deception and the spread of misinformation. Artists and creators must exercise caution and act responsibly when utilizing AI-generated content.
  4. Transparency and Responsible Use: It is crucial for artists and creators to be transparent about their use of AI in the creative process and to give proper credit where it is due. Responsible and ethical use of AI should be a guiding principle to maintain trust and integrity in the artistic community.


Best Practices for Ethical and Responsible AI Usage

To ensure the ethical and responsible use of AI in music video production, artists and creators should follow these best practices:


  1. Acknowledge AI's Role: When using AI-assisted tools, it is important to acknowledge the role of AI in the creative process and give proper credit to the algorithms and technologies involved.
  2. Use AI as a Tool, Not a Replacement: AI should be utilized as a tool to augment human creativity and artistic expression, rather than relying solely on AI-generated content. Artists should maintain their unique creative voices and artistic integrity.
  3. Human Oversight and Quality Control: While AI can streamline and automate certain tasks, human oversight and quality control are still essential. Artists and creators should review and refine AI-generated content to ensure it aligns with their artistic vision and maintains high standards.
  4. Respect Intellectual Property Rights: When using AI-generated content or third-party assets, it is crucial to respect intellectual property rights and obtain the necessary permissions and licenses to avoid copyright infringement.
  5. Ethical Use of Synthetic Media: If utilizing AI to manipulate or create synthetic media, exercise caution and act responsibly to avoid potential misuse or deception.
  6. Continuous Learning and Adaptation: As AI technology continues to evolve, it is important for artists and creators to stay informed about emerging ethical considerations and best practices, adapting their approaches as needed.


By following these best practices, artists and creators can leverage the power of AI in music video production while upholding ethical standards and maintaining the integrity of their artistic endeavors.
